- Introduction to the session and overview of week 2 content.
- Discussion of the Iris dataset: features, target, and classification.
- Introduction to the Titanic dataset and binary classification.
- Exploration of the MovieLens dataset and data merging.
- Discussion of high-dimensional bioinformatics dataset.
- Presentation of time series data and its characteristics.
- Analysis of movie reviews dataset for sentiment analysis.
- Credit card fraud detection dataset and anonymized features.
- NYC taxi trip dataset and brainstorming potential analyses.
